Overview


Name   rcrQ   Type   Regulator
Locus tag   BL8807_RS04765 Genome accession   NZ_CP062948
Coordinates   1295337..1297163 (+) Length   608 a.a.
NCBI ID   WP_072726932.1    Uniprot ID   -
Organism   Bifidobacterium lemurum strain DSM 28807     
Function   regulate competence (predicted from homology)
